Grease traps and FOG: what they do in a commercial kitchen plumbing system

In a busy commercial kitchen, a small interceptor does big protective work for your plumbing. We use straightforward terms: a grease trap is a separation chamber placed between sinks and the sewer to intercept FOG before it reaches your pipes.

How wastewater slows to separate fats, oils, and grease

The unit slows wastewater so it cools. As the flow drops, fats and oils rise to form a floating layer while heavier food solids settle as sludge. Clearer water moves on to the sewer with much less debris.

Where grease, solids, and water sit inside the trap

Inside you’ll find three zones: a top grease layer, a middle water layer, and a bottom solids layer. That layering explains why partial service leaves recurring buildup.

Why keeping FOG out of drains protects pipes and city infrastructure

When FOG stays out of your drains, your pipes stay open longer and risk of sewer system blockages drops. Local rules exist because escaped FOG can re-solidify downstream and cause costly backups.

Why grease traps cause foul odors and blockages when maintenance is delayed

Left unattended, a build-up inside your kitchen interceptor quickly becomes a source of persistent smells and service interruptions.

FOG buildup and food waste decomposition

Warm, wet conditions let fats and food particles break down. This process releases gases such as hydrogen sulfide that produce strong, foul odors.

Clogs, stagnation, and plumbing escalation

As sludge grows, flow slows and water stagnates. Slow drains can become recurring clogs, then backups into sinks or floor drains, and eventually overflow that halts service.

Worn lids, failing seals, and leaking smells

Old covers or damaged gaskets let gases escape into kitchens and dining areas. Even when the unit sits under a cabinet, leaking seals create obvious odor issues and staff complaints.

Ventilation faults that trap gases

Blocked or faulty venting keeps odor-causing gases inside the system and forces them out where people work and eat.

How does grease trap cleaning prevent blockages and bad odors?

Stopping buildup at the source saves time, money, and unexpected shutdowns. We focus on complete removal of the floating cap, solids, and residues so your drains carry waste freely and your staff works without disruption.

Removing the top layer before it hardens

The top layer of fats rises and forms a cap that can shear off and travel downstream. Early removal keeps that material from hardening in your pipes and narrowing flow.

Pumping out settled solids and sludge

Solids collect at the bottom and slow water movement. Our pump-outs clear sludge that causes stagnation and leads to backups during busy service hours.

Scrubbing internal walls and crossover areas

Real service goes beyond vacuuming. We wash and scrub walls, baffles, and crossover passages to stop quick recurrence of residue and new buildup.

Cutting the food source for bacteria

By removing decomposing waste, we reduce the fuel that feeds odor-causing bacteria. That controls foul odors at the source rather than just masking them.

Grease trap cleaning steps that actually work for odor control

Effective odor management combines full waste removal, tight seals, and proper venting. We lay out clear, practical steps you can expect from our services so your kitchen stays compliant and comfortable.

Schedule a professional pump-out

Start with a complete pump-out to remove accumulated waste, not just a surface skim. Leftover sludge keeps decomposing and fuels odors, so total removal matters for long-term results.

Inspect and replace lid gaskets

Worn seals let gases escape into work and dining areas. We inspect gaskets on every visit and replace damaged seals to keep smells contained.

Confirm ventilation is working

Blocked vents push gases back into the building. Our crew checks vents and confirms the system vents safely, reducing the chance of recurring complaints.

Use enzyme cleaners as a supplement

Enzymes can help digest residual organics between services, but they are a support tool — not a substitute for scheduled professional service and required pump-outs.

Choosing the right cleaning frequency for your kitchen operations

The right interval depends on your menu, volume, and wastewater patterns. We help you set a plan that matches daily demands so your staff works without surprise downtime.

Many commercial kitchens schedule service every one to three months. High-volume sites need service more often to avoid loss of capacity during peak hours.

Typical service intervals and why high-volume kitchens need more frequent attention

Small operations with low-fat menus can often go longer between visits. Full-service or fried-food kitchens fill units faster and need shorter intervals.

How buildup rate changes based on menu, prep, and wastewater load

Menu choices, prep style, and wastewater volume speed accumulation. More food fats and solids mean quicker fills, so trap maintenance must reflect real use, not guesswork.

Grease trap chemicals and biological treatments: what helps, what can backfire

Not every additive helps long-term performance; some quick fixes create new problems down the line. We recommend viewing treatment programs as a support for regular maintenance, never a replacement for scheduled pump-outs.

Bacterial treatments that digest FOG over time

Bacterial options introduce live cultures that feed on oils and organic waste. Over several weeks they reduce accumulation by converting matter into water and carbon dioxide.

These products work best as an ongoing program. They are gradual, not instant, and suit sites that pair them with regular service.

Emulsifying agents: quick action, clear risk

Emulsifiers liquefy deposits fast. That sounds useful, but the liquefied material can travel and re-solidify in the sewer system.

The main risk is downstream re-solidification, which may cause sewer issues or violate rules.

Compliance, inspections, and proper grease trap waste disposal in the United States

Keeping accurate records and following local rules saves businesses from costly citations and interruptions. Regular maintenance, commonly required every three months, reduces the chance of violations tied to odors, backups, or improper handling.

Inspectors typically review service records and proof of scheduled work. They look for clear dates of pump-outs, signs of overflow, and visible performance problems that point to missed upkeep.

Why upkeep matters

Proper care protects your license and your staff. Routine checks and documented service lower the risk of fines and health-code issues that harm your business reputation.

What inspectors expect

Expect requests for documented service, evidence of routine maintenance, and no visible overflow or leaks. Good records show the unit was treated on schedule and repaired when needed.

Responsible disposal and treatment practices

Disposal of waste and wastewater must follow local regulations. Removing waste is only half the job; correct handling and transport protect the sewer and public infrastructure.

What role do grease traps and FOG play in a commercial kitchen plumbing system?

In a commercial kitchen, grease traps slow wastewater so fats, oils, and grease (FOG) separate from water. Heavier solids settle to the bottom while lighter FOG rises to form a layer, protecting downstream pipes and the municipal sewer system from clogging and costly damage.

How does a grease trap actually separate grease, solids, and water?

The device reduces flow velocity, giving time for solids to fall out and oils to float up. Internal baffles and crossover passages keep those layers apart so clearer water leaves the trap while FOG and sludge remain for removal during service.

Why is keeping FOG out of drains so important for pipes and sewers?

When FOG reaches pipes or the municipal sewer, it sticks to walls and builds up, narrowing passages and causing blockages, backups, and overflows. Regular maintenance prevents system failures, costly repairs, and health-code violations.

What causes foul odors and blockages when maintenance is delayed?

Over time FOG and trapped food waste decompose, producing hydrogen sulfide and other smelly gases. Solid accumulation and hardened grease narrow flow paths, leading to slow drains, backups, and potential overflows that amplify odors.

How do worn lids, seals, or ventilation issues make odor problems worse?

Damaged gaskets and lids let gases escape into kitchens and dining areas. Poor venting traps odor-causing gases in the system instead of allowing them to disperse safely, so even a cleaned trap can still smell if seals or vents fail.

What specific actions during a professional service remove the floating grease layer before it hardens?

Technicians pump out the trap and remove the floating cap manually, before it solidifies and migrates into pipes. Prompt removal stops the formation of hard deposits that are expensive to remove.

How does pumping out solids and sludge reduce backups?

Removing settled solids and sludge restores the trap’s capacity and flow rate. That prevents flow restriction that causes slow drainage and backups during busy periods.

Why is scrubbing internal walls, baffles, and crossover areas important?

Grease clings to interior surfaces. Scrubbing removes residual buildup that would otherwise reintroduce grease into the wastewater stream and accelerate recurrence of clogs and odors.

How does cleaning reduce bacterial food sources and control foul odors?

By eliminating grease and food solids, cleaning removes the nutrients bacteria feed on. With fewer nutrients, bacterial activity and production of odorous gases like hydrogen sulfide drop significantly.

Can biological or chemical treatments replace mechanical pump-outs?

No. Biological treatments can aid ongoing maintenance by breaking down FOG, but they don’t remove accumulated sludge. Emulsifiers act fast but can allow grease to travel and re-solidify in downstream pipes, creating new problems.

What risks come with using additives or emulsifiers?

Emulsifying agents can push FOG out of the trap where it may re-form farther down the system, causing blockages. Some additives face municipal restrictions, so they must be used carefully and in compliance with local rules.
